[PATCH mm-unstable] mm: rmap: abstract updating per-node and per-memcg stats

From: Yosry Ahmed
Date: Mon May 06 2024 - 17:13:46 EST


A lot of intricacies go into updating the stats when adding or removing
mappings: which stat index to use and which function. Abstract this away
into a new static helper in rmap.c, __folio_mod_stat().

This adds an unnecessary call to folio_test_anon() in
__folio_add_anon_rmap() and __folio_add_file_rmap(). However, the folio
struct should already be in the cache at this point, so it shouldn't
cause any noticeable overhead.

No functional change intended.

+static void __folio_mod_stat(struct folio *folio, int nr, int nr_pmdmapped)
+{
+ int idx;
+
+ if (nr) {
+ idx = folio_test_anon(folio) ? NR_ANON_MAPPED : NR_FILE_MAPPED;
+ __lruvec_stat_mod_folio(folio, idx, nr);
+ }
+ if (nr_pmdmapped) {
+ if (folio_test_anon(folio)) {
+ idx = NR_ANON_THPS;
+ __lruvec_stat_mod_folio(folio, idx, nr_pmdmapped);
+ } else {
+ /* NR_*_PMDMAPPED are not maintained per-memcg */
+ idx = folio_test_swapbacked(folio) ?
+ NR_SHMEM_PMDMAPPED : NR_FILE_PMDMAPPED;
+ __mod_node_page_state(folio_pgdat(folio), idx,
+ nr_pmdmapped);
+ }
+ }
+}
